三层架构网格软件SCE的健壮性测试方法研究.pptxVIP

三层架构网格软件SCE的健壮性测试方法研究.pptx

  1. 1、本文档共27页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

三层架构网格软件SCE的健壮性测试方法研究汇报人:2024-01-15

目录contents引言三层架构网格软件SCE概述健壮性测试方法研究实验设计与实现结果讨论与对比分析结论与展望

01引言

网格计算的发展网格计算作为一种新型的计算模式,能够将地理上分布的各种资源集成在一起,为用户提供高性能计算和数据处理等服务。随着网格计算的不断发展,其应用领域也越来越广泛,如科学计算、工程仿真、数据挖掘等。网格软件的健壮性需求在网格计算中,网格软件的健壮性至关重要。由于网格环境的动态性和不确定性,网格软件需要具备自适应、容错和恢复等能力,以确保在出现故障或异常时能够继续提供服务。因此,研究网格软件的健壮性测试方法具有重要意义。研究背景与意义

目前,国内外学者已经对网格软件的健壮性测试方法进行了广泛的研究。其中,主要包括基于故障注入的测试方法、基于模拟的测试方法、基于形式化验证的测试方法等。这些方法各有优缺点,但都存在一些局限性,如无法全面覆盖故障场景、测试效率低下等。国内外研究现状随着网格计算的不断发展和应用需求的不断提高,网格软件的健壮性测试方法也在不断发展和完善。未来,网格软件的健壮性测试方法将更加注重全面性和高效性,同时结合人工智能、大数据等技术手段,实现更加智能化和自动化的测试。发展趋势国内外研究现状及发展趋势

研究内容本文旨在研究三层架构网格软件SCE的健壮性测试方法。首先,分析SCE的架构特点和健壮性需求;其次,设计并实现一种基于故障注入的SCE健壮性测试方法;最后,通过实验验证该方法的有效性和可行性。研究目的本文的研究目的是提出一种针对三层架构网格软件SCE的健壮性测试方法,该方法能够全面覆盖SCE可能出现的故障场景,提高SCE的健壮性和可靠性。同时,该方法也可以为其他类似的三层架构网格软件的健壮性测试提供参考和借鉴。研究方法本文采用理论分析和实验验证相结合的研究方法。首先,对SCE的架构特点和健壮性需求进行深入分析;其次,设计并实现一种基于故障注入的SCE健壮性测试方法;最后,通过实验验证该方法的有效性和可行性。在实验过程中,将采用真实的网格环境和模拟的故障场景进行测试,并对测试结果进行详细的分析和讨论。研究内容、目的和方法

02三层架构网格软件SCE概述

三层架构网格软件的定义与特点定义三层架构网格软件是一种基于分布式计算环境的软件架构,它将应用程序划分为表示层、业务逻辑层和数据访问层三个层次,通过网络通信实现各层次之间的交互。特点具有模块化、松耦合、高内聚、可重用和易于维护等特点。同时,它还能够提高系统的可扩展性、可移植性和可靠性。

功能要求SCE需要提供丰富的功能,包括任务调度、资源管理、数据存储、安全控制等,以满足网格计算环境的复杂需求。性能要求SCE需要具备高性能的计算能力、高效的任务调度算法、稳定的资源管理机制和可靠的数据存储方案,以确保网格计算环境的高效运行。SCE的功能与性能要求

VSSCE的健壮性是指其在异常或极端情况下能够保持正常运行并恢复的能力,包括容错性、恢复性和可维护性等方面。重要性在网格计算环境中,由于节点故障、网络中断等异常情况不可避免,因此SCE的健壮性对于保障网格计算环境的稳定性和可靠性至关重要。通过提高SCE的健壮性,可以降低系统故障率、减少维护成本并提高用户体验。健壮性定义SCE的健壮性及其重要性

03健壮性测试方法研究

健壮性测试是一种软件测试方法,旨在验证系统在异常或极端条件下的表现。它关注系统在面临压力、错误输入或资源限制等情况下的稳定性和可靠性。通过模拟各种异常情况,健壮性测试旨在发现系统中的潜在问题,确保系统能够在不利条件下正常运行,并为用户提供良好的体验。概念目的健壮性测试的概念和目的

负载测试通过模拟大量用户同时访问系统,验证系统的性能和稳定性。优点是可以发现性能瓶颈和并发问题,缺点是难以覆盖所有异常情况。压力测试将系统置于极端负载下,以测试其崩溃点。优点是可以发现系统的极限和故障模式,缺点是可能导致系统崩溃或数据损坏。错误输入测试向系统提供无效或错误的输入,以验证其容错能力。优点是可以发现输入验证和错误处理方面的问题,缺点是难以覆盖所有可能的错误输入情况。资源限制测试限制系统的资源(如内存、CPU、网络带宽等),以测试其在资源不足的情况下的表现。优点是可以发现资源管理和优化方面的问题,缺点是难以准确模拟实际环境中的资源限制情况见的健壮性测试方法及其优缺点

针对SCE的健壮性测试方法设计基于场景的测试设计:根据SCE的实际应用场景和需求,设计具有代表性的测试场景,包括正常场景、异常场景和极端场景等。通过模拟这些场景下的用户行为和系统负载,验证SCE的健壮性。故障注入测试:通过故意引入故障或错误,模拟SCE在实际运行中可能遇到的各种问题。例如,可以注入网

文档评论(0)

kuailelaifenxian + 关注
官方认证
文档贡献者

该用户很懒,什么也没介绍

认证主体太仓市沙溪镇牛文库商务信息咨询服务部
IP属地上海
统一社会信用代码/组织机构代码
92320585MA1WRHUU8N

1亿VIP精品文档

相关文档